Wilson of Stamford mahogany



The 12" dial and case are in excellent condition and the movement benefits from a full service last year. This strike is on a wire (not a bell). The case has two side doors (typical of a clock not a timepiece which generally has one). The side doors have fish scale style brass inserts. The clock has a cast brass key operated bezel with a convex glass. The case is solid mahogany with a well figured front veneer and mahogany carved wings and front decoration. Overall a high quality clock of the period.
